HELP: Calling All Grounds crew!!!!

Featured Replies

There was a very strong thunderstorm over Joe Robbie Stadium tonight......just minutes before the football team started their pre-season scrimmage. The storm dumped almost 2 inches of rain. The football team is tearing up our outfield and infield grass. This will be a huge challenge for the grounds crew. It may potentially cause a weather related postponment of tomorrow's game, but I doubt it. I think the grounds crew can do a good job and the game will go on. But the field condition will be a factor tomorrow....equal for both teams.
